Afraid of hospitals, shots, and doctors? Then come visit Dr. Anton's Fix-It-All Hospital! A hospital that's always kind to its patients, no matter how busy it gets, and a doctor who can clearly diagnose even the trickiest of ailments — wouldn't everyone want to visit a place like that? That's exactly what Dr. Anton's Fix-It-All Hospital is like.
From a rooster who's lost his voice and can't crow, to a tiger who caught a cold waiting for prey and fell asleep, to a crocodile whose jaw got stuck from yawning too wide — no matter who walks through the door, Dr. Anton treats every patient with kindness and precision. But one day, while examining a patient, Dr. Anton suddenly collapses to the floor. What could have happened to him?
Filled with gentle humor, this picture book helps ease children's fears about hospitals and doctors, while delivering the reassuring message that even when we're hurt or sick, we can get better. Meet Book 1 of the beloved series Dr. Anton's Fix-It-All Hospital, with over 680,000 copies sold across Asia.

Most young children dread going to the hospital almost as much as they dread being sick. Unfamiliar places, meeting a doctor, getting shots, or taking medicine — these memories aren't exactly pleasant. So parents sometimes resort to gentle threats ('something bad will happen if you don't go!') or little white lies ('we're going somewhere fun!') just to get their child through the door. But threats and lies can't truly ease a child's fear.
Dr. Anton's Fix-It-All Hospital is like a prescription in picture book form — one designed to soothe children's hospital anxiety. Dr. Anton, the star of the series, is a wonderfully skilled doctor who can pinpoint exactly what's wrong with his patients. He's so busy he sometimes forgets to eat, but he always greets his patients with a warm, gentle smile and asks kindly where it hurts — even when his patients happen to be a tiger or a crocodile! That's why Dr. Anton's Fix-It-All Animal Hospital is always bustling with animal friends of every kind.
Today is an especially busy day, with all sorts of ailing patients arriving one after another: a tiger with a cold, a crocodile with his jaw stuck wide open, a snake with a sore back, a flamingo with a numb leg, and an elephant with a twisted trunk! Dr. Anton is rushed off his feet treating one animal after another. Just when he finally gets a moment to breathe, a goat arrives complaining of having no energy at all. When Dr. Anton asks if something's been troubling her, she admits that she's been sad ever since her close friend moved far away. Dr. Anton listens patiently to her long story to help ease her heavy heart… and then, suddenly, he collapses to the floor!
The startled animals rush over and press a stethoscope to his belly — only to hear an enormous growling sound. It turns out Dr. Anton has been so busy caring for patients since morning that he hasn't eaten a single bite all day.
Inside the hospital, the doctor cares for his patients. Outside the hospital, the patients care for their doctor — a warm story of neighbors looking after one another.
When the animal friends hear that Dr. Anton has collapsed, they all gather together. They bring vegetables and fruit gathered from the forest to the hospital and set out to cook something special for him. With a flurry of chopping and the cheerful bubbling of a pot, they whip up a hearty, nourishing soup! Dr. Anton eats until he's full and quickly regains his strength.
While the animal friends may be patients inside the hospital, outside its doors they are Dr. Anton's caring neighbors. Their warm hearts — remembering his kindness and looking after him in return — bring a happy smile to every reader's face.
